
Hogenakkal Falls Tamil Nadu
Hogenakkal Falls is a waterfall in South India on the Kaveri River. It is situated in the Dharmapuri region of the southern Indian condition of Tamil Nadu, around 180 km from Bangalore and 46 km from Dharmapuri town. It is now and again alluded to as the “Niagara of India” With its acclaim for restorative showers and shroud watercraft rides, it is a noteworthy site of vacation spot. Carbonatite rocks in this site are thought to be the most seasoned of its kind in South Asia and one of the most seasoned on the planet. This is additionally the site of a proposed task to create drinking water.

Etymology:
When the water falls on the stones it shows up as though hoge (smoke in Kannada) is exuding from the highest point of the kal (rock in Kannada) on account of the power of the water, henceforth Hogenakkal (smoking rocks). It is likewise called as Marikottayam by the general population of Tamil Nadu.
River:
The Kaveri River is considered to shape at Talakaveri in the Brahmagiri slopes in Kodagu locale in Karnataka and assembles energy as the area drops in rise. It gets to be bigger as different tributaries encourage into it in transit down. At Hogenakkal, the Kaveri, now a vast waterway, drops and makes various waterfalls as the water slices through the rough territory. In spots the water falls as much as 20 m and is said to sound like ceaseless thunder. Not long after the falls the stream takes a Southerly course and enters the Mettur store. The waterway conveys silt which makes the “down-stream” land fertile.At Hogenakkal the stream spreads out over a wide zone of sandy shorelines, then courses through to the Mettur Dam and makes a 60 sq mi. lake called Stanley Reservoir. Worked in 1934, this anticipate enhanced watering system and gave hydropower.

Boating:
Boating in Hogenakkal is permitted amid the dry-season as the water falls are not solid to disturb the section of the pontoons. Neighborhood coracles work from the banks of both Tamil Nadu and Karnataka banks of the chasm. This is the fundamental wellspring of salary for these pontoon administrators.The base of the vessels are made water verification by the utilization of stows away, yet in some cases with sheets of plastic Use of plastics in the Hogenakkal region, not only for pontoons, has been condemned because of issues with contamination. These vessels are directed and moved utilizing a solitary oar, making them one of a kind.
Theerthamalai:
Theerthamalai is a mainstream pigrim focus and it is 16 k.m. from Harur in Dharmapuri locale. This explorer and excursion focus turning out to be exceptionally well known with the general population. The sanctuary arranged around one k.m up the precarious incline of a hillock gets that its name from the five springs in the sanctuary. Ruler Theerthagireeswar (Lord Shiva) is the venerating divinity. As indicated by the legend it was here that Lord Rama adored Lord Shiva to exonerate himself of the transgression of having executed a few evil spirits in the war against Ravana. Thus there is conviction that a sacred dunk in the waters of this spring will wipe out the transgressions submitted by the general population.
As indicated by the legend, keeping in mind the end goal to love to Lord Shiva, Rama sent Hanuman to bring water from the River Ganga, however when Hanuman did not return at the delegated time for pooja, Rama unleashed a bolt onto the rough slant of the hillock and water sprang forward, which today is called Rama Theertham.
